World zinc prices may be bottoming, as per William Adams, analyst of Basemetals.com.

William Adams said:

World zinc prices of 77 cents per pound this week are almost 40% lower than the 2008 peak of USD 1.28 reached in early March 2008 and are below marginal productions costs due to huge metal surplus and weak demand in major zinc consuming regions.
